Hua Mei Café — Restaurant in San Diego

Name
Hua Mei Café
Description
Counter-serve stand at San Diego Zoo selling Chinese, Japanese & Asian fusion eats, plus beer.

Do NOT order anything here, for the food here is not only pricey but also tastes horrible. We visited a few days ago and ordered 3 meals: an orange chicken bowl, a chicken nugget & fries, and a teriyaki chicken bowl (kids meal). Total cost was over $40. We thought despite the high price tag we could satisfy our craving for some Chinese food. Only a few bites revealed how wrong we were. The orange chicken was too sweet and too sour, the teriyaki chicken was too salty, the chicken nuggets were so dry and salty, even the rice wasn't cooked right because it's way too mushy. We're not picky eaters, but no adult or child in our family liked any food there at all. After trying a few bites, my wife almost puked. Had to throw most of the expensive meals into the garbage. We have been cooking and eating Chinese food for 5 decades. This restaurant offers the worst we've...

A very dysfunctional establishment. From 5 ordering windows only two are open. The manager, Tim, is walking around with their hands in their pockets when the line goes around the corner. Cashiers serving drinks heavily slow everything down, as you will give me a pager for my food, serve the drinks along with the food as I need to wait anyways! The person handing out the food can take care of the drinks. That way the queue goes fast, everyone goes to sit down, there are no delays and we get everything together in one go. I've been in this queue for 40 minutes now!

UPDATE: I finally got my food. 3 sad chicken strips on the kids meal which are as dry as they come. The chicken teriyaki is very salty, fatty and has massive chunks of veggies. The orange chicken is ok. I would not...
